Provide equipment names and any visible labels from a safe position. Do not remove electrical covers or enter restricted areas to obtain information. Repeatedly resetting a device or recreating the fault is not a substitute for an investigation.
Different protective devices respond to different conditions
Overcurrent protection responds to current beyond its operating characteristics, including overloads and short-circuit faults. Residual-current protection responds to an imbalance associated with current leaving its intended path. Some devices combine functions. Identifying the device is part of understanding the event. The same description, “the power keeps tripping”, can refer to different protective functions and different investigation routes. A competent electrician uses the installation details and appropriate checks to establish the cause.
Look at timing and connected changes
A fault that occurs when particular equipment starts needs a different investigation from a problem that follows wet weather or appears only during periods of high demand. Records of timing and operating conditions make an intermittent issue easier to investigate.
Recent changes matter, but they do not prove causation. New equipment, alterations or maintenance should be included in the history so the investigation considers them alongside the existing installation.
Keep the investigation and repair distinct
The first attendance establishes the reported issue, affected installation and relevant findings. The repair then follows the confirmed cause. Replacing a protective device without establishing why it operated can leave the underlying fault unresolved.
The work record should state the checks, findings, action taken and operating condition left. If the fault is not reproduced, agree the evidence or further investigation needed rather than marking the original concern as disproved.
Respond to dangerous symptoms
Keep people away from damaged electrical equipment and report the condition promptly. Smoke, fire or immediate danger to life requires the emergency services. Water affecting electrical equipment needs appropriate control and competent assessment; do not approach or handle the affected equipment.

FAQs
Does a trip always mean a faulty appliance?
No. The cause can involve connected equipment, loading or the installation. Investigation identifies which part of the system needs attention.
What if the fault disappears before attendance?
Provide the history and conditions when it occurred. The report should explain what the checks establish and whether further evidence is needed.
What information helps the electrician?
Give the affected location, timing, equipment operating, recent changes and previous reports. Include photographs only when they can be taken safely.
